After building an image with this kit last night, we've obviously got a 
lot of work to do to get the size of the boot archive back down to an 
acceptable level.  Looks like getting 64-bit and 32-bit pulled back 
apart would do perhaps half of it, but poking around a bit, a couple of 
things that caught my eye:

- we really will have to prune usr to a more limited subset; need to 
sort out whether there's a re-factoring of packages to propose or 
whether we want to try to add some file-level tagging in IPS

- DTrace toolkit doesn't need to be in the archive, it's not used until 
after the cd is mounted

- var/sadm in the archive should just be a link to the one on the CD

- the optimizations that are currently commented out at the end of the 
post-process script probably need to be added back in
